Output 08388e389229e3c69031e53b11c3018c164fbc1bf02c90ebcda0b862ce528fa9:1

value
30287000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81a94b1921e63921067a01fe2b49265ab148a542 OP_EQUALVERIFY OP_CHECKSIG
address
1CpayTMn2JUutyZqYymoCVBqjpuGiLYPHF
transaction
08388e389229e3c69031e53b11c3018c164fbc1bf02c90ebcda0b862ce528fa9
spent
true